Tilray Brands Inc

TLRY trades at $4.30, down 4.44% today, reflecting ongoing investor skepticism despite record fiscal 2026 revenue of $915 million. The stock shows bearish technical signals with key support at $4.00, while fundamentals reveal significant challenges including negative net income margins (-13.26%) and consecutive earnings misses. Recent developments include strategic partnerships expansion in New York and California spirits markets and increased medical cannabis production capacity to 275 metric tonnes.

TLRY faces substantial execution risks with persistent losses and negative cash flow, though trading below book value (P/B 0.37) offers potential value. Analyst consensus remains cautious with 65% hold ratings, while regulatory progress in cannabis remains a key catalyst. The stock requires successful margin improvement and U.S. regulatory clarity for sustained recovery.

About RLX Technology Inc

RLX Technology Inc. is a leading e-vapor company in China, focusing on the research, development, and sale of e-vapor products. The company primarily operates under the RELX brand, offering a range of closed-system e-vapor products designed to deliver a high-quality user experience. RLX's business model is centered on product innovation, strong brand building, and a vast distribution network across China.

About Tilray Brands Inc

Tilray is a Canadian company that grows and sells medical and recreational cannabis. In 2021, Aphria acquired Tilray in a reverse merger and adopted the Tilray name. Most of its sales come from Canada and international medical cannabis exports, while its U.S. business focuses on CBD products and alcohol.
